A large-scale update of the Apple Intelligence ecosystem, the development of the Siri voice assistant into a more powerful Siri AI, and new artificial intelligence capabilities were the main announcements at the Apple presentation, which took place on the evening of June 8. These developments will gradually begin to appear on the company's devices in the fall. However, Russian users of Apple products will not have access to the new Siri AI features — it is not supported in Russia and in Russian. In general, the presentation was without high-profile premieres: neither the folding iPhone Ultra, nor new Mac models or other devices were presented, and experts pointed out Apple's systematic unwillingness to present its new flagships.

Cook's Last Big Conference

On June 8, Apple introduced the next stage of Apple Intelligence development — a new version of the Siri AI voice assistant. For its work, the company uses Google Gemini technologies as part of a long-term partnership with Google. As you know, Google does not officially provide Gemini features in Russia, access to the service for users from the Russian Federation is limited. Izvestia found out that Russians will not be able to access Siri AI if they are physically located in the Russian Federation, and the service itself will still work in 16 languages, but there is no Russian among them.

"Changing the language and region can help users get the desired access to Siri AI beta testing, but out of the box in the Russian Federation, these functions will be unavailable for obvious reasons," said Sergey Pomortsev, an IT expert.

The information was confirmed by Ilya Sklyuyev, editor of the projects "Non-artificial Intelligence" and "Non-digital Economy". The expert noted that US law explicitly prohibits the provision of advanced AI services in some countries, including Russia. This also applies to embedded AI assistants in mobile devices.

— Simple and stupid Siri is one thing. Another thing is the advanced Gemini—based assistant. It's all about access to cutting-edge technology. None of the chatbots of foreign companies, except perhaps Chinese ones, has so far been available without means of circumventing restrictions," the expert stated.

At the same time, the company devoted the main timing of the ceremony to the AI aspects. Apple Intelligence and Siri AI should help Apple close the gap with competitors in the field of generative artificial intelligence. According to the developers, the updated AI agent is capable of advanced computing and tasks on par with the flagship ChatGPT and Grok models. Since Siri now uses Google's advanced Gemini technology, it has learned new tricks: for example, ordering food from multiple locations, combining it into a single receipt and shared delivery using conventional voice control.

According to Artem Funtikov, editor of the iGuides portal, the Apple WWDC26 developer conference, which opened on June 8, was Apple's attempt to restart its AI strategy after the controversial launch of Apple Intelligence a year earlier.

— WWDC 26 was not as bright as it used to be, but rather pragmatic. The company has been criticized for its "catching up" position in the AI field for several years now, and it is not surprising that instead of a show, we were shown a strategically verified event for investors as proof of the existence of a mature ecosystem," the expert noted.

One of the central announcements was the new version of Siri AI. The voice assistant received a more natural conversational mode, learned to take into account the user's personal context based on mail, messages and calendar data, as well as perform chains of related actions on a single command. In addition, Apple has given developers access to third-party AI models, including OpenAI and Google solutions, which will expand the capabilities of applications within the company's ecosystem. In addition, users will now be able to create complex action scenarios in natural language without having to manually configure commands.

The Image Playground service has also received a major update. Apple has focused on better image generation and expanding the creative capabilities of its built-in AI tools. In addition, the company has introduced new features for automatic subtitle creation, improved accessibility tools, and introduced a number of intelligent features for working with text and multimedia content.

Betting on productivity and ecosystem

In iOS 27, the company has retained the concept of a "liquid glass"-style interface, while improving the user-friendliness of the system. The camera application has received significant changes: users will be able to independently adjust the location of the main controls, forming their own shooting interface.

Apple has placed a special emphasis on optimizing operating systems. The company continues to get rid of outdated code components, which should have a positive impact on device performance and battery life.

Parents have been given the opportunity to limit the screen time of children's accounts in the new iOS 27, and all data used by the AI system is now stored locally and not sent to Apple servers.

There were no significant exclusive innovations for the iPad. Tablets have received almost the same set of AI functions as the iPhone. watchOS has new watch faces and interface improvements, but the expected AI trainer based on data from the Health app was not included in the final version of the system.

In macOS 27, one of the most notable news was the final end of support for computers running on Intel processors. From now on, the operating system will focus exclusively on devices with Apple's proprietary Silicon chips.

This decision is of strategic importance for the company, believes Sergey Pomortsev.

— Dropping Intel support allows Apple to focus resources on a single hardware architecture. This simplifies development, accelerates the implementation of new artificial intelligence features, and opens up additional opportunities to optimize energy consumption and performance. For users of M-series devices, the benefits will become more noticeable with each update," he stressed.

What awaits Apple after the leadership change

Despite the large number of software innovations, the conference did not have any high-profile hardware premieres. Neither the folding iPhone Ultra, nor the new Mac models or other devices that previously appeared in the leaks were presented. Industry experts pointed out Apple's unwillingness to present its foldable flagship and noted that its systematic postponements have been taking place since September 2024.

According to the analysts interviewed, this approach may indicate the preparation of a separate large-scale announcement in the fall. That's when the company traditionally introduces a new generation of smartphones and other key products.

— The last two years have been stormy for Apple: stagnating iPhone sales in China, regulatory pressure in the EU, antitrust lawsuits in the United States, and, most importantly, the feeling that the company has missed the AI revolution, mired in hardware self-replays and problems in creating Siri. Now everything depends on the success of AI as the main marketing engine of our time. In this vein, Apple will have to try hard to jump on the departing train, despite the fact that its competitors have already sat in the first cars," added Artem Funtikov.

At the same time, Apple's new mascot, the blue—and-white Little Finder Guy, has gained sudden fame, in fact, a tiny anthropomorphic version of the classic Mac Finder icon. Users rushed to create memes with this character, and he was also included in the WWDC26 gift set.

The Apple Summer Forum will surely go down in history as the last major presentation of the company led by Tim Cook. In the fall, the company will not only launch new devices, but also begin a new management era under the leadership of John Ternus, who will determine the further development of the largest technology corporation in the United States. Izvestia previously wrote about what it might be like.

At the same time, the bookmakers' bets that Cook would publicly and officially hand over the CEO's baton to Ternus did not materialize. As a farewell, he only said that it was an honor for him to "help Apple stay ahead of everyone else."
